Budget CD player/Amp/Speaker combination?
Question:

I know this forum is entitled "DVD and Home Cinema Hardware" but I hope you won't mind if I squeeze in a small audio hardware question ;)
I am replacing my ageing Technics "all in one" stereo system as it is starting to fail a little after 15 years stirling service.
I am thinking of going initially for an amp, a CD player and some speakers. Then adding a maybe a tuner, cassette player, turntable and mini disc seperates at a later date.
Looking though the Richer Sounds catalogue they seem to recommend as a good budget system:
Technics SLPG3 CD player £59.95
Cambridge Audio A1 amp £59.95
Mission 700 speakers £49.95 a pair
I play a wide variety of CD's (pop, rock, dance, top 40, indie etc)
The other consideration is that the CD player must have an optical digital out to record to my portable mini disc player.
Price obviously plays a part as well and for the 3 inital purchases (plus cables) I don't really want to go much above £200 if possible.
I do also have a slight bias towards Technics but only as my current system is Technics and has been so good for so long and am willing to be converted to the dark side.
I would greatly appreciate opinions, alternatives and advice.
Thanks in advance :)

Answers:


The Missions are fine and will do the job well.
Leave the Cambridge Amp and get a Sony one if money is tight.
The Technics CD player is not a patch on even the most cheapest Sony say the CDPXE270.
If you are adverse to Sony then look at NAD or Marantz - but it will take you well over budget.
A Sony CD player coupled with a Sony Amp with the Missions will be sweet. Add qnect 1 or 2 cables plus cheapish speaker lengths and you'll be amazed at the sound.
